eSpeak NG is an open source speech synthesizer that supports more than hundred languages and accents.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

pl_rules 4.7K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370371372373374375376377378379380381382383384385386387388389390391392393394395396397398399400401402403404405406407408409
  1. .group a
  2. a a
  3. a (_A a_
  4. ae (_ E // latin plural
  5. // czasowniki forma przypuszczająca - trzecia sylaba od końca
  6. @ł) a (by_ =a
  7. @ł) a (bym_ =a
  8. @ł) a (byś_ =a
  9. @) a (łby_ =a
  10. @) a (łbym_ =a
  11. @) a (łbyś_ =a
  12. .group ą
  13. ą O~
  14. ą (_ O~_
  15. ą (_A O~_
  16. ą (p Om
  17. ą (b Om
  18. ą (t On
  19. ą (c On
  20. ą (d On
  21. ą (ć On^
  22. ą (dź On^
  23. ą (ci On^
  24. ą (dzi On^
  25. ą (k ON
  26. ą (g ON
  27. ą (l O
  28. ą (ł O
  29. .group b
  30. b b
  31. ja) bł (ko p
  32. b (_A p
  33. b (i b;
  34. bi (A b;j
  35. .group c
  36. c ts
  37. ch h
  38. ch (i C
  39. chi (A hj
  40. psy) chi (a Ci
  41. c (i ts;
  42. ci (A ts;
  43. cz tS
  44. c (osin k
  45. c (osecans k
  46. c (otang k
  47. cose) c (ans k
  48. ch (ev S // chevrolet
  49. ch (err S
  50. _ro) ck (A k
  51. .group ć
  52. ć ts;
  53. ć (b dz;
  54. ć (g dz;
  55. .group d
  56. d d
  57. d (_A t
  58. d (i d;
  59. di (A dj
  60. dz dz
  61. dz (_A ts
  62. dz (i dz;
  63. dzi (A dz;
  64. dź dz;
  65. dź (_A ts;
  66. dż dZ
  67. dż (_A tS
  68. _o) dż d|Z
  69. _po) dż d|Z
  70. .group e
  71. e E
  72. _osi) e (mset_ =E
  73. _sied) e (mset_ =E
  74. e (_A E_
  75. .group ~
  76. ~
  77. .group ę
  78. ę E~
  79. ę (_ E
  80. ę (_A E_
  81. ę (p Em
  82. ę (b Em
  83. ę (t En
  84. ę (c En
  85. ę (d En
  86. _dziewi) ę (ćset =En^
  87. ęć (dzie En^
  88. ę (dzi En^ // kędzior
  89. ę (ci En^
  90. ę (ć En^
  91. ę (si En^
  92. ę (ś En^
  93. ę (dź En^
  94. ę (k EN
  95. ę (g EN
  96. ę (l E
  97. ę (ł E
  98. i) ę (tna E // piętnaście
  99. .group f
  100. f f
  101. fi (A f;j
  102. .group g
  103. g g
  104. g (i g;
  105. hi) gi (e gj
  106. g (_A k
  107. gł (_ g
  108. gł (_A k
  109. gate (s gEjt
  110. .group h
  111. h h
  112. hi (A hj
  113. h (i C
  114. .group i
  115. i i
  116. i (A_+ j
  117. A) i (A j
  118. C) i (A ;
  119. _kl) i (e ;ij
  120. _martyn) i (k i
  121. _martyn) i (c i
  122. _kon) i (c++ i
  123. _kon) i (k++ i
  124. _lajkon) i (c i
  125. _lajkon) i (k i
  126. // pentatonika etc. - not complete yet
  127. @n) i (kA_ =i
  128. @n) i (ce_ =i
  129. @n) i (kach_ =i
  130. @n) i (ków_ =i
  131. @n) i (kom_ =i
  132. @tm) i (kA_ =i
  133. @tm) i (ce_ =i
  134. @tm) i (kach_ =i
  135. @tm) i (ków_ =i
  136. @tm) i (kom_ =i
  137. // czasowniki tryb przypuszczający
  138. @) i (łby_ =i
  139. @) i (łbym_ =i
  140. @) i (łbyś_ =i
  141. @l) i (by_ =i
  142. @n) i (by_ =i
  143. @l) i (śmy_ =i
  144. @n) i (ście_ =i
  145. @l) i (ście_ =i
  146. @) i (byśmy_ =i
  147. @) i (byście_ =i
  148. @C) ie (libyśmy_ =;E
  149. @C) ie (libyście_ =;E
  150. @C) ie (liby_ =;E
  151. @C) ia (łybyśmy_ =;a
  152. @C) ia (łybyście_ =;a
  153. @C) ia (łyby_ =;a
  154. .group j
  155. j j
  156. .group k
  157. k k
  158. k (i c
  159. kł (_ k
  160. ki (A kj
  161. .group l
  162. l l
  163. l (_ l_
  164. li (A lj
  165. _po) li (A li
  166. .group ł
  167. ł w
  168. A) ł (_ w_
  169. mys) ł (_ w_
  170. ł (_
  171. .group m
  172. m m
  173. m (_ m_
  174. A) mi (A mj
  175. _zie) mi (A m;
  176. _) mj (rA majO
  177. .group n
  178. n n
  179. n (_ n_
  180. n (i n^
  181. ni (A n^;
  182. n (k N
  183. n (g N
  184. n (ć n^
  185. n (ci n^
  186. n (dź n^
  187. n (dzi n^
  188. .group ń
  189. ń n^
  190. ń (_ n^_
  191. .group o
  192. o O
  193. o (_A O_
  194. // notebook + declination
  195. _n) oteboo (C Owtbu
  196. .group ó
  197. ó u
  198. .group p
  199. p p
  200. ph (A f
  201. _ko) pi (A pj
  202. _fotoko) pi (A pj
  203. // base form also in 'pl_list'
  204. _) ppł (k pOtpuwkOvni
  205. _) ppł (c pOtpuwkOvni
  206. _) pł (k puwkOvni
  207. _) pł (c puwkOvni
  208. .group q
  209. q k
  210. qu (A kv // quorum
  211. .group r
  212. r *
  213. K) r (A @-*
  214. ri (A *j
  215. rz Z
  216. c) rz (A S
  217. ć) rz (A S
  218. cz) rz (A S
  219. f) rz (A S
  220. h) rz S
  221. k) rz S
  222. p) rz S
  223. s) rz (A S
  224. ś) rz (A S
  225. sz) rz (A S
  226. t) rz S
  227. r (zi *
  228. A) r (zł * // obmierzły
  229. ma) r (zn r // marznąć etc.
  230. ma) r (zlin * // zmarzlina
  231. _zama) r (za * // zamarzać
  232. _zma) r (za *
  233. odma) r (za *
  234. .group s
  235. s s
  236. si (nus si
  237. si (liko si
  238. elik) si (r si
  239. plek) si (g si
  240. _mak) si (_ si
  241. _mak) si (m si
  242. s (i S;
  243. si (A S;
  244. sz S
  245. .group ś
  246. ś S;
  247. ść (dzie Z;
  248. .group t
  249. t t
  250. t (i t;
  251. ti (A tj
  252. t (rz t| // trzetrzelewska
  253. t (s t|
  254. .group u
  255. u u
  256. u(_A u_
  257. a) u w // autobus
  258. e) u w
  259. na) u (k u
  260. na) u (cz u
  261. de) u (s u
  262. .group v
  263. v v
  264. .group w
  265. w v
  266. ier) wsz (A S // pierwszy
  267. w (_A f
  268. c) w (A f
  269. ć) w (A f
  270. cz) w (A f
  271. f) w (A f
  272. h) w (A f
  273. k) w (A f
  274. p) w (A f
  275. s) w (A f
  276. ś) w (A f
  277. sz) w (A f
  278. t) w (A f
  279. _) window wyndOw
  280. .group x
  281. x ks
  282. .group y
  283. y y
  284. y (_A y_
  285. _) y (A j
  286. czter) y (stA =y
  287. _pat) y (++ y
  288. @t) y (kA_ =y
  289. @t) y (ce_ =y
  290. @t) y (kach_ =y
  291. @t) y (ków_ =y
  292. @t) y (kom_ =y
  293. muz) y (kA_ =y
  294. muz) y (ce_ =y
  295. muz) y (kach_ =y
  296. muz) y (ków_ =y
  297. muz) y (kom_ =y
  298. // czasowniki i spójniki
  299. @ł) y (byśmy_ =y
  300. @ł) y (byście_ =y
  301. @ł) y (by_ =y
  302. eb) y (śmy_ =y
  303. eb) y (ście_ =y
  304. _ab) y (ście_ =y
  305. _ab) y (śmy_ =y
  306. .group z
  307. z z
  308. z (_A s
  309. z (i Z;
  310. zi (A Z;
  311. _ro) z (iC z
  312. .group ź
  313. ź Z;
  314. ź (_A S;
  315. .group ż
  316. ż Z
  317. ż (_A S
  318. // "Polished" pronunciation
  319. .group th
  320. _e) th (anak t // my nick!!!
  321. th s
  322. _) th z
  323. // "Polished" simple pronunciation of some foreign letters
  324. .group ü
  325. ü i
  326. .group ö
  327. ö E
  328. .group ä
  329. ä E
  330. .group ž
  331. ž Z
  332. .group č
  333. č tS
  334. .group š
  335. š S
  336. // ... and some common non-alphabetic characters
  337. .group
  338. $ dOla*
  339. @ mawpa
  340. % p@-*OtsEnt
  341. + plus
  342. # haS
  343. = *'uvna||S;E
  344. / dz;ElOnE
  345. * gv;astka
  346. | k@-*Eska||p;OnOva
  347. ^ pOtENga
  348. & End
  349. ` Odv@-*Otny||apOst@-*Of